Understanding Odds and Probability

Odds are the backbone of betting, expressing the likelihood of an event occurring. Getting a grip on how odds work can tilt the scales in your favor. There are mainly three formats for odds: fractional, decimal, and moneyline.

  • Fractional Odds: These look like 5/1, meaning for every £1 bet, £5 is won.
  • Decimal Odds: Seen as 6.00, this includes your stake in the payout, showing total return.
  • Moneyline Odds: Common in the US, e.g., +500, indicating a £500 profit on a £100 bet.

Betting on underdogs may seem sketchy at first, but it often offers better value than backing favorites. Understanding how to assess the implied probabilities from these odds can lead you to identify value bets more effectively.

Bankroll Management Techniques

One of the most critical aspects of betting success is managing your finances wisely. It’s easy to get swept up in the excitement, but a disciplined approach to your bankroll can save you from making hasty decisions that could reward you with regret.
Some effective techniques include:

  • Setting a Budget: Define how much you're willing to invest in betting over a specified period. Stick to this budget.
  • Unit Betting: Bet a consistent percentage of your bankroll on each wager. This method prevents large losses from a single bad bet.
  • Record Keeping: Maintain a detailed log of your bets, wins, and losses. This helps in evaluating your strategy.

Ultimately, every bettor will hit rough patches. How you manage your bankroll during these times sets apart winners and losers. Effective bankroll management helps cushion the blow, so even if the chips are down, you still have wiggle room for your next bet.

Historical Context

The Premier League’s history is rich and complex, weaving together tales of triumph, failure, and evolution. Established in 1992, it transformed English football, resulting in both local and global fervor. Surging TV rights deals and the influx of international talents changed the way teams operate, and booking odds reflect these shifts. For instance, the rise of clubs like Manchester City and Chelsea, fueled by substantial financial investments, has created competitive disparities. Understanding how past events intertwine with the present contributes to better predictions. Consider how specific teams historically perform in certain venues—something that often informs odds and can benefit bettors who do their homework.

Over/Under Bets

Next, we move to over/under bets, also known as totals betting. This type invites you to wager on whether the total number of goals scored in a match will exceed or fall below a specified figure set by the bookmakers. It’s perfect for those who like to bet without having to pick a winner. These bets require a deeper analysis of both teams’ scoring capabilities and defensive stats.

Important elements include:

  • Offensive and Defensive Metrics: Consider how many goals each team typically scores and concedes.
  • Game Context: The significance of the match can alter the way teams approach the game. A mid-table side is likely to play differently in a must-win situation compared to a simple league game.
  • Weather Conditions: Believe it or not, heavy rain or strong winds can lead to fewer goals as teams struggle to control the ball.

Accumulators

Lastly, we cannot overlook accumulators, known as accas in betting circles. They involve combining several selections into one bet to enhance the potential payout. The allure is in the risky thrill and the promise of higher returns, but let’s not sugarcoat it — they are harder to land consistently.

Key points to keep in mind when placing accumulator bets:

  • Research Each Selection: It’s easy to get carried away, but each leg must be carefully considered; don’t just stack favourites for the sake of a higher payout.
  • Bookmaker Offers: Some bookmakers offer enhanced odds on accumulators or even insurance bets that refund losses on selected accas.
  • Diversify Your Bets: Instead of putting all eggs in one basket, consider mixing types of bets across several games for broader coverage.

Utilizing Metrics

To really get the most out of statistical analysis, you have to get comfortable with a variety of metrics. This includes everything from win-loss records to more intricate statistics like expected goals (xG) and possession percentages. These metrics can reveal much about a team’s strengths and weaknesses. For instance, if a team has a high xG but consistently fails to convert chances, that may be a strong indicator that their fortunes could change in future matches. Here are some key metrics to consider:

  • Goals For and Against: Basic yet crucial numbers indicating how many goals a team scores versus how many they concede.
  • Win Rates: A simple calculation of how many matches a team wins compared to how many they play.
  • Head-to-Head Statistics: Historical performance between two teams can offer insights into potential outcomes.
  • Player Statistics: Evaluating individual player metrics can help assess injuries or form fluctuations.

Data Sources

Having access to the right data sources is vital. Not all statistics are created equal, and reputable sources can make a world of difference. Many bettors turn to websites like Wikipedia, Britannica for foundational information or even deeper dives into player stats on platforms like Reddit. Other popular sites include:

  • Opta Sports: Renowned for providing in-depth metrics and analytics.
  • StatsBomb: Offers detailed football analytics focused on understanding game strategy.
  • FBref: A free and user-friendly site for comprehensive player and team stats.

Using multiple sources can help you cross-verify information and reduce reliance on potentially biased or incomplete data.

Psychological Biases

Psychological biases manifest in various ways when punters place bets. Confirmation bias, for instance, occurs when bettors favor information aligning with their existing beliefs. If they believe a particular team is invincible due to past wins, they might disregard present performance trends that suggest otherwise.

Another common bias is the sunk cost fallacy, where bettors cling to past investments and losses. They might pour more money into a failing bet out of desperation to recoup losses instead of cutting their losses and walking away. This flawed decision-making can lead to spiraling wagers with disastrous results.

Understanding these biases opens a doorway to more rational betting. A bettor aware of these factors can approach each bet with a clearer mind, questioning their motivations and decisions. To mitigate biases:

  • Regularly review past bets to analyze success and failure without emotional attachment.
  • Seek diverse opinions to counteract confirmation bias.
  • Embrace loss as part of the game to escape the sunk cost trap.

Odds Movements

Odds movements serve as a barometer for market sentiment. When betting odds fluctuate, they often reflect changes in public perception and insider information about team conditions, player injuries, or other influencing factors. For instance, if a key player suddenly sustains an injury ahead of a match, you'll likely notice significant shifts in the odds for that game. These shifts indicate not just where money is flowing but also potential value bets.

It's vital to observe these movements over time. For example, if Manchester City’s odds drop leading up to a match against a struggling Norwich City side, it may indicate that the betting community expects a solid performance from the favored team. Conversely, a rise in odds for the underdog usually suggests more confidence in their ability to perform better than anticipated.

"Understanding odds movements can be the difference between a successful bet and a costly mistake."

This concept can also apply to the timing of when you place your bets. Betting close to the match can yield different odds than if you had placed a bet days in advance. Some bettors prefer to wait until just before kickoff to gauge the final team line-ups and momentum, while others bet early for the best odds available.

Bookmakers are the gatekeepers of betting markets and greatly influence the betting dynamic. Their odds are often reflective of various factors, including statistical analysis, player performance, and even media coverage. Understanding how bookmakers set their odds is crucial for anyone interested in maximizing their betting strategy.

Bookmakers utilize algorithms and expert assessments to adjust betting lines based on incoming wagers. For instance, if a large number of bets come in for Liverpool to win against Chelsea, the bookmaker may adjust the odds to mitigate risk and ensure they maintain a balanced book. This often means moving the line to attract bets on the opposing team and maintaining their profit margin.

Choosing the right bookmaker can also result in significantly different odds for the same outcome. It’s worth spending some time comparing odds between various platforms, as a small difference can affect payouts considerably over time. Many experienced bettors will often open accounts with multiple bookmakers to take advantage of these discrepancies.

Value Betting

Value betting is rooted in the principle of identifying discrepancies between one’s own estimates and the odds provided by bookmakers. If the perceived likelihood of an outcome is higher than what the odds suggest, that’s a potential gold mine. In essence, if you reckon that a team’s likelihood of winning is 60%, yet the bookmakers present odds that suggest only a 50% chance, you’ve uncovered a value bet. This strategy involves systematic analysis and a keen understanding of statistical models, which serve as the backbone for your evaluations.

Benefits of Value Betting:

  • Capitalizing on Mistakes: Bookmakers sometimes miss the mark when setting odds, and savvy bettors can benefit by seizing these moments.
  • Long-term Profitability: By consistently betting on value plays, even when losing in the short term, bettors can see substantial returns over time.
  • Lower Risk: Value bets are backed by analysis, meaning your stakes are rooted in reason rather than impulse.

Considerations:

  • Compound Factors: Injuries, weather conditions, and matchday dynamics all play significant roles; thus, maintaining an adaptive perspective on variables is vital.
  • Requires Rigor: To identify value consistently, one must invest time in research and be equipped to deal with skepticism from one’s own judgment.

Arbitrage Betting

Arbitrage betting or arb betting, as the name implies, relies on exploiting differences in odds offered by different bookmakers to guarantee a profit regardless of the match outcome. Typically, this requires placing multiple bets across various platforms at calculated odds, ensuring that at least one bet will yield a profit.

How it Works:

  1. Identifying Opportunities: Bettors should monitor odds across several betting sites. An example could be a match between Team A and Team B, where one bookmaker favors Team A heavily while another sees Team B as likely to win.
  2. Calculating Stakes: Once favorable odds are found, calculating the stakes for each bookmaker based on their odds allows a bettor to secure guaranteed profits.
  3. Placing Bets: Place the determined bets simultaneously to lock in the opportunity.

Benefits of Arbitrage Betting:

  • Guaranteed Returns: If executed correctly, the profit is secure irrespective of the match’s outcome.
  • No Need for Betting Proficiency: Unlike value betting, this strategy minimizes risk tied to team performance analytics.

Considerations:

  • Bookmaker Scrutiny: Frequent arb betting may lead to accounts being flagged or limited by bookmakers eager to mitigate their own risk.
  • Time-Consuming: It demands diligence and precision in tracking odds across platforms, which can be cumbersome.

Understanding Gambling Laws

Gambling laws vary greatly between countries and even within regions of the same country. In the UK, the Gambling Act of 2005 is a cornerstone legal framework that governs various types of gambling, including sports betting. This act sets out the responsibilities of operators, aiming to protect punters and prevent unlawful gambling activities.

Key points to consider include:

  • Licenses: Only operators with a valid license from the UK Gambling Commission can offer their services legally. It ensures they maintain high standards about fairness and transparency.
  • Age Restrictions: You need to be at least 18 years old to place bets. Operators must implement strict age verification measures to enforce this regulation.
  • Consumer Rights: Players have the right to complain if they are treated unfairly. The laws allow individuals to seek restitution in case of disputes or unfair practices, promoting a safer betting environment.

Setting a Budget

Setting a budget is the cornerstone of creating a successful betting bankroll. You should consider several factors when determining this:

  • Income Level: How much disposable income do you have? Never allocate money you depend on for living expenses. Betting should be fun, not a necessity.
  • Goals: What do you aim to achieve with your betting? Whether it’s for entertainment or to try and generate profit, having clear objectives guides how much you should put into your bankroll.
  • Accountability: Keeping track of your spending is essential. Use tools or apps that help you monitor where your money goes in your betting activity.

The rule of thumb often suggested is to limit your betting to 1-2% of your total bankroll on a single wager. This helps ensure you can weather the ups and downs that come with betting.

Bankroll Management Strategies

The next stride in managing your bankroll involves implementing bankroll management strategies. These strategies not only help you preserve your funds but also enhance your betting performance. Here are several key strategies to consider:

  • Staking Plans: Consider whether you want to use a flat staking plan, where you wager the same amount on every bet, or a percentage plan, which adjusts your stakes according to your current bankroll size. Each approach has its merits depending on your risk appetite.
  • Diversification: Just as in investing, spreading your bets across different matches can cushion the blow of any single loss. It’s a way of mixing your potential risks and rewards.
  • Review and Adjust: Every few weeks, take the time to review your overall performance. Understanding what is working and what isn’t allows you to adjust your strategy and manage your bankroll effectively.
